As you have not described briefly and if I am not wrong you wanted to trim the spaces at beginning right ?
then my answer is, you can handle it many way and one possible way is to handle this in the following way also. Some sample code I have written here in below, you can check with that, its running perfectly in my sample application:
private void textBox1_KeyPress(object sender, KeyPressEventArgs e)
{
if ((textBox1.SelectionStart == 0) && (e.KeyChar == (char)Keys.Space))
{
e.Handled = true;
}
}
private void textBox1_TextChanged(object sender, EventArgs e)
{
//Store the back up of Current Cursor Possition.
int cusorpos = textBox1.SelectionStart;
if (false == string.IsNullOrEmpty(textBox1.Text))
{
if (textBox1.Text[0] == ' ')
{
//Trim Spaces at beginning.
textBox1.Text = textBox1.Text.TrimStart(' ');
//Set the Cursor position to current Position.
textBox1.SelectionStart = cusorpos;
}
}
}
as you can see here i wrote two events its because if any body paste a text with spaces at beginning, in your textbox control then it will work perfectly to remove the spaces from the beginning.
